ABC News Stands By Hastert Report; Ross Cites “Disconnect” & “Semantics Issue”

By Brian 

On Thursday’s World News Tonight, Brian Ross updated viewers on the story he broke Wednesday: That Dennis Hastert “was among those whose dealings with Jack Abramoff the FBI has been looking into.” According to Hotline, Elizabeth Vargas “spoke of a ‘storm of reaction'” about the original report. Ross’s update recognized that “ABC News was denounced by his Republican colleagues” on the House floor Thursday morning. But he said ABC News stands by its report.

In Friday’s WP, Howard Kurtz recaps the issue and talks to Ross. “I think our story is accurate,” he says. “We’ve gone back to our sources, and they believe what we reported was accurate as they knew it. There seems to be some disconnect between what the congressman thinks, what the Justice Department thinks and what the FBI thinks… There may be a semantics issue here as to what constitutes being under investigation.”
